This guide is for use by all stakeholders in dredging projects, which include consultants, existing and potential clients, project financiers, insurers and dredging contractors. The publication offers a standard method to establish the capital and related costs of various types of dredging plant and equipment commonly in use. It is divided into four sections:
Chapter 1: Introduction.
Chapter 2: Description of the most common dredgers and dredging equipment used.
Chapter 3: A summary of the principles of cost standards.
Chapter 4: Cost standard tables.
